Shop Review: Doubleday

Shop: Doubleday
Products: Books, CDs and DVDs
Pro: Fast and reliable, stock newly released titles
Cons: limited range, more expensive compared to other online bookstore
Payment Methods accepted:  credit cards

Comments:

I only bought from doubleday because I bought a coupon from cudo.com.au that gave me $50 worth of purchase for $19. I wanted to buy a particular book then and when I checked the price on doubleday, it’s so much more expensive compared to other online shop but because of the coupon, I can buy another book so I decided it was worth it. Without the coupon, I definitely wouldn’t buy it because the book I was after was priced $28.95 there while in bigw.com.au the same book only costed $18.74. That’s $10 difference!

The range of books they’re offering is also quite limited to newly released title. Although this also means, they’re very fast in shipping because they only sell what they stock. Although if you buy in-stock items from other shops, it will also be as fast.

So in my opinion, double check with other online bookstores such as Big W, Borders, or Booktopia before buying. Although doubleday seems to be cheaper than your local bookstore because they sell below RRP, most of other online stores sell even cheaper with the same quality of service.
